This Is Me

I want to exist in the corners,
Wish to see my life from a 3d view,
Rustle around in known place like foreigners,
Hoping my disguise would carry me through.

Why do I want this?
I don't know.
This is me,
That's all I know.

One, Two and turn, elegantly roam like the knight,
And suddenly disappear like Houdini with a sleight.
To move all around with nothingness,
Jumping off from the fence of pretense.

Being stuck somewhere in between the line,
Wanting to rise and shine.
Yet to not care a damn about this world,
Lying on a hammock,reading a book,all curled.

 I shut my eyes and I see stars that shine bright,
 Sleep empowers and sweetly kisses me good night.
 Paving way to a kaleidoscope of patterns in my mind,
 Waking up to a morning with no thoughts left behind.

Why do I want this?
I don't know.
This is me,
That's all I know...
